vuejs/eslint-plugin-vue: Official ESLint plugin for Vue.js

3869
STARS
59
WATCHERS
599
FORKS
124
ISSUES

eslint-plugin-vue Recent Issues

Issue Title State Comments Created Date Updated Date
edit `v-on-function-call` to enforce `@click="() => fn()"` over `@click="fn()"` and `@click="fn"` open 2 2022-10-05 2022-10-06
Conflicting peer dependency: eslint-plugin-vue on NPM 8 closed 6 2022-10-03 2022-10-06
Meta: Improve tools and templates open 0 2022-09-30 2022-10-06
Format CSS and SCSS code inside <style> section in .vue files closed 1 2022-09-29 2022-10-06
require-prop-comment open 1 2022-09-28 2022-09-26
require-prop-comment closed 1 2022-09-28 2022-09-26
Update JS env and remove or update parserOptions.ecmaVersion open 0 2022-09-28 2022-10-06
Rule proposal: Enforce property reactivity for Vue 2 open 0 2022-09-27 2022-10-06
Support for react-like .tsx function components open 0 2022-09-22 2022-10-06
add `no-required-prop-with-default` rule to vue2 and vue3 presets open 0 2022-09-22 2022-10-06
`vue/define-macros-order` false positive with using `export` open 3 2022-09-19 2022-10-06
`vue/no-ref-as-operand` should not autofix when variable is `Ref | NotARef` closed 2 2022-09-17 2022-10-06
Support JSX/TSX in `vue/max-attributes-per-line` closed 1 2022-09-17 2022-10-06
`vue/padding-line-between-tags` with new 'consistent' option closed 9 2022-09-17 2022-10-06
[no-undef-components] false positive for "setup" components closed 2 2022-09-16 2022-10-06
`vue/padding-line-between-tags` Support singleline/multiline options open 3 2022-09-16 2022-10-06
new rule: enforce `<script setup>` over regular `<script>` closed 1 2022-09-14 2022-10-06
tag-attr-order `<script lang="ts" setup>` vs `<script setup lang="ts">` open 6 2022-09-14 2022-10-06
Nuxt 3: auto imported ref will not trigger `vue/no-ref-as-operand` warning open 3 2022-09-12 2022-10-06
Warn destructing attrs & slots open 12 2022-09-09 2022-10-06
vue/no-undef-components is expected to report error if component is type only closed 1 2022-09-08 2022-10-06
Duplicate keys detected: '2bb27d26-21aa-43ba-8266-07c2d6b9c02f'. This may cause an update error. closed 1 2022-09-05 2022-10-06
vue/require-valid-default-prop not always detecting interface in seperate .ts file open 7 2022-09-05 2022-10-06
Force TypeScript only defineEmits closed 1 2022-09-05 2022-10-06
Force TypeScript only defineProps closed 7 2022-09-05 2022-10-06
vue/html-indent Ignore the format of the comment content open 3 2022-09-02 2022-09-26
`no-ref-as-operand` rule does not work in some cases closed 0 2022-08-30 2022-09-26
vue/attributes-order does not work in my project closed 5 2022-08-30 2022-09-26
vue/attributes-order: Prioritize v-if/v-else/v-else-if to v-for in SFC templates in Vue 3 open 4 2022-08-28 2022-09-26
Deprecate shareable configs open 6 2022-08-25 2022-09-26
valid-attribute-name closed 5 2022-08-23 2022-09-26
Rule Proposal: `vue/no-ref-object-destructure` rule closed 1 2022-08-17 2022-09-26
Add support for Reactivity Transform open 1 2022-08-17 2022-09-26
Support for type-based prop declarations and default values closed 1 2022-08-16 2022-09-26
Rule define-macros-order don't allow require statements closed 2 2022-08-15 2022-09-26
Definition for rule 'vue/component-name-in-template-casing' was not found closed 1 2022-08-13 2022-09-26
"attributes-order" rule ignores "v-bind" attribute closed 1 2022-08-09 2022-09-26
Help: [Parsing error: Maximum call stack size exceeded] dont know why this happen & how to fix it closed 0 2022-07-27 2022-09-26
template v-for key conflict closed 1 2022-07-27 2022-09-26
Rule suggestion: `vue/no-use-v-else-with-v-for` open 11 2022-07-25 2022-09-26
This plugin is not designed to work well for split files. We recommend that you combine the files into a single file. Also, I think maybe you can use the `// @vue/component` comment. closed 0 2022-07-22 2022-09-26
`vue/valid-next-tick` is reported when use nested callback + `nextTick` closed 2 2022-07-20 2022-09-26
Eslint not showing errors in vscode with docker closed 1 2022-07-16 2022-09-26
`vue/no-setup-props-destructure` should also warn when using `toRefs` open 0 2022-07-15 2022-10-03
Unexpected `vue / require-valid-default-prop` error occurs closed 2 2022-07-14 2022-09-26
ERESOLVE Peer dependencies closed 6 2022-07-13 2022-09-26
Multi-word-component-names and no-reserved-component-names closed 1 2022-07-11 2022-09-26
`vue/custom-event-name-casing` does not report when using template literals closed 0 2022-07-09 2022-09-26
[vue/no-unused-components][bug] can't use vnode in vue2 closed 3 2022-07-08 2022-09-26
Quotes on style and script tags aren't auto fixed closed 2 2022-07-07 2022-09-26

vuejs's Other Repos